H8200495791 8200495791 226A4-7260R O2 Oxygen Sensor For Dacia DOKKER Express DUSTER Box LODGY LOGAN SANDERO MCV II 1.2 TCe
sku: 1005003017273708
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$17.80
Shipping from: China
Price history chart & currency exchange rate